Iowa rolls to win over Westlake, sets up showdown with LCCP

Published 1:06 am Wednesday, January 31, 2024

WESTLAKE — After taking their first loss since Dec. 28 on Saturday, Iowa turned in a dominating performance Tuesday to beat Westlake 72-39 on the road.

Iowa (won for the 14th time in 15 games and set up a big District 3-3A game on Friday against Lake Charles College Prep at Iowa High School. Lake Charles College Prep (11-7, 3-0) beat St. Louis Catholic (14-9, 2-2) 63-50 to win its 10th consecutive game.

Desamonte Gradney scored a game-high 19 points for Iowa, and Dashawn Ceaser finished with 13.

Iowa has won four district games by an average of 39.5 points and outscored Westlake 37-23 in the second half.

Westlake (12-8, 1-2) led once on their opening shot by Ryan Allen followed by an Iowa 10-0 run.

Iowa turned an eight-point lead into a 31-16 halftime advantage after outscoring the Rams 17-6 in the second quarter. Gradney opened the second quarter with back-to-back buckets, and Makaylin Jackson came off the bench to hit a pair of 3-pointers as the Yellow Jackets opened the quarter on a 10-0 run.

D.J. Garriet led the Rams with 15 points, while Ryan Allen finished with 10.
